Red Deer Weather in December

Thinking of visiting Red Deer in December? Expect very low temperatures reaching -3°C (27°F) during the day, dropping to -13°C (9°F) at night, with some snowfall likely.

Rainfall in Red Deer in December

Snow is expected on roughly 8 days, totalling around 19 mm (0.7 in) for the month. Rain this month is fairly typical, a standard mix of wet and dry days with no particularly heavy or persistent showers.

Temperature in Red Deer in December

Expect highs of -3°C (27°F) in Red Deer in December, with nights dropping to around -13°C (9°F). The winter season takes place during December. Cold conditions tend to persist from morning through evening, so be prepared for winter weather. At -13°C (9°F) overnight, frost and ice are likely outside. What to Wear in Red Deer in December

We recommend you pack up your warm winter gear for Red Deer in December. If you have insulated boots, thermal layers, and a heavy winter coat that can handle snow and freezing temperatures it's smart to bring them. Don't forget gloves, a warm hat, and a scarf. Almost no rain is expected, so no need to bring rain gear.
